PIE Airport Terminal Overview

PIE has one main terminal divided into two concourses:

A‑Side (Gates 1–6)

  • Gate 1 is arrivals‑only

  • Used for many Allegiant Air flights

B‑Side (Gates 7–12)

  • Gate 12 is arrivals‑only

  • Short walking distances

PIE is compact, clean, and extremely easy to navigate — no trams, no long walks, no confusion.


Before & After Security at PIE

Before Security

  • Airline check‑in counters (primarily Allegiant Air)

  • TSA security checkpoint

  • Rental car counters

  • Visitor information

  • Restrooms & ATM

After Security

  • Access to both concourses

  • Dining & drinks

  • Convenience shops

  • Water refill stations

  • Nursing room

  • Restrooms

Everything is within a short walk — PIE is designed for efficiency.


PIE Airport Security Tips

PIE has one TSA checkpoint for all passengers.

Lines are usually manageable, but early morning and weekend flights can get busy.

Tampa Lady Drivers Tip:   Arrive 90 minutes before your flight — no need for the 2–3 hours required at larger airports like TPA.

Baggage Claim & Ground Transportation

Baggage Claim

Located on the first floor with two carousels and direct access to transportation.

Rental Cars

  • Avis

  • Budget

  • Enterprise

  • Hertz

  • National

  • Alamo

Rideshare & Taxis

  • Uber & Lyft curbside

  • Local taxi services

  • Select hotel shuttles

Tampa Lady Drivers Tip:   Use the cell phone lot when picking someone up — no need to circle.


PIE Parking Options

PIE offers three main parking choices:

  • Short‑Term Parking – Closest to the terminal

  • Long‑Term Parking – Affordable and convenient

  • Economy Lot – Best value for extended trips

Parking at PIE is generally easier and cheaper than at Tampa International Airport (TPA).


PIE Arrivals Guide

  • Arrivals enter on the first floor

  • Gates 1 and 12 are arrivals‑only

  • Baggage claim is directly ahead

  • Ground transportation is just outside

You can be curbside within minutes.


PIE Departures Guide

  • Check‑in on the second floor

  • One TSA checkpoint

  • After security, follow signs to A‑Side or B‑Side

  • Gates are close together — no long walks

PIE is one of the most traveler‑friendly airports in Florida.


Airlines at PIE

PIE is primarily served by Allegiant Air, offering nonstop flights to dozens of U.S. cities, especially Midwest and East Coast destinations.
